Mark as Favourite

ABLab Solutions comes out with an exhaustive hand on Training program on Internet of Things based on the actual Industry demands. This course would provide the participants knowledge and experience on the fast growing field of Internet of Things. The program is an ideal foundation for Engineering, Diploma and Science students striving to enter this exciting field.

Course Outline

Introduction to IoT

  • What is IoT?
  • Basics of IoT
  • Application of IoT

Introduction to Embedded System

  • What is an Embedded System?
  • Basic parts of an Embedded System
  • Application of Embedded System
  • Examples of Embedded System

Overview of Basic Electronic 

  • Current and Voltage
  • Ohm’s Law
  • Resistors and Capacitors
  • Voltage Divider Rule
  • Diodes and Transistors
  • Applications of Resistors, Capacitors, Diodes and Transistors

Overview of Digital Electronic 

  • Number Systems
  • Logic Levels / Logic Values
  • Logic Gates, Truth Tables and Boolean Equations
  • 8-Bit Registers

Overview of Microprocessor and Microcontroller

  • What is Microprocessor and Microcontroller?
  • Basic Parts of Microprocessor and Microcontroller
  • Difference between Microprocessor and Microcontroller
  • Applications of Microprocessors and Microcontrollers
  • Examples of Microprocessors and Microcontrollers

Arduino and Arduino Sketch

  • What is Arduino?
  • What is Open Source Microcontroller Platform?
  • History of Arduino
  • Arduino IDE Software-Sketch
  • Installation of Arduino IDE
  • USB to Serial Driver
  • Installation of USB to Serial Driver
  • Different Arduino Boards

Arduino UNO Board

  • What is Arduino UNO?
  • Features of Arduino UNO
  • Know your Arduino Board
  • PINOUTs of Arduino UNO

Input/Output Ports & Input/Output Devices

  • What is an Input/Output Port?
  • What is an Input Device?
  • Examples of Input Devices
  • What is an Output Device?
  • Examples of Output Devices

Input/Output Ports of Arduino UNO

  • Digital Pins on Arduino UNO
  • pinMode() in Arduino UNO
  • digitalWrite() in Arduino UNO
  • Pull-up & Pull-Down Resistors
  • How to enable internal pull-up in Arduino UNO?
  • digitalRead() in Arduino UNO

Light Emitting Diodes(LED) and Arduino UNO

  • What is a Light Emitting Diode (LED)?
  • Circuit Diagram of LED Interfacing with Arduino UNO
  • LED Interfacing with Arduino UNO
  • LED Blinking with Arduino UNO

16X2 Alphanumeric LCD with Arduino UNO

  • What is a 16X2 Alphanumeric LCD?
  • How a 16X2 Alphanumeric LCD works?
  • Pinouts of 16X2 Alphanumeric LCD
  • Circuit Diagram of 16X2 Alphanumeric LCD Interfacing with Arduino UNO
  • 16X2 Alphanumeric LCD Interfacing with Arduino UNO
  • Horizontal Scrolling in 16X2 Alphanumeric LCD with Arduino UNO

Universal Synchronous and Asynchronous Receiver and Transmitter (USART) and Arduino UNO

  • What is Communication Protocol?
  • Serial and Parallel Communication
  • Universal Synchronous or Asynchronous Receiver and Transmitter (USART) Communication Protocol
  • Hardware and Software USARTs of Arduino UNO
  • Serial Monitor on Arduino
  • Application of USART Communication Protocol

PC Communication with Arduino UNO

  • PC to Arduino UNO Communication
  • Arduino UNO to PC Communication
  • Full Duplex Communication Between PC and Arduino UNO

Analog to Digital Conversion(ADC) and Arduino UNO

  • What is an Analog to Digital Converter (ADC)?
  • How Analog to Digital Converter (ADC) Works?
  • Analog to Digital Converter(ADC) of Arduino UNO
  • analogRead() in Arduino UNO
  • Analog to Digital Converter of Arduino UNO and LCD Display
  • Analog to Digital Converter of Arduino UNO and Serial Monitor
  • Application of Analog to Digital Converter(ADC)

Different Sensor Interfacing with Arduino

  • What is a MQ-5 LPG Gas Sensor?
  • How MQ-5 LPG Gas Sensor Works?
  • Circuit Diagram of MQ-5 LPG Gas Sensor Interfacing with Arduino UNO
  • MQ-5 LPG Gas Sensor Interfacing with Arduino UNO and LCD Display
  • MQ-5 LPG Gas Sensor Interfacing with Arduino UNO and Serial Monitor
  • What is a Temperature Sensor?
  • How Temperature Sensor Works?
  • Pin Description of LM35 Temperature Sensor
  • Circuit Diagram of LM35 Temperature Sensor Interfacing with Arduino UNO
  • LM35 Temperature Sensor Interfacing with Arduino UNO and LCD Display
  • LM35 Temperature Sensor Interfacing with Arduino UNO and Serial Monitor

DC Motor, DC Motor Driver and Arduino UNO

  • What is a DC Motor?
  • How DC Motor Works?
  • Different types of DC Motor
  • DC Motor Driver
  • H-Bridge Driver
  • Circuit Diagram of L293D based DC Motor Driver Interfacing with Arduino UNO
  • L293D based DC Motor Driver Interfacing with Arduino UNO in 5V Mode
  • Application of DC Motor

Relay, Relay Driver and Arduino UNO

  • What is a Relay?
  • How Relay works?
  • What is a Relay Driver?
  • Circuit Diagram of Relay Driver
  • Circuit Diagram of Relay Interfacing with Arduino UNO
  • Relay Interfacing with Arduino UNO
  • Application of Relay

Computer Networking, Internet and Cloud Computing

  • Networking Fundamentals
  • Types of Networks
  • What is Internet and World Wide Web?
  • What is a Brower?
  • Fundamentals of Centralized Computing and Server-Client Model
  • Cloud Computing

Wi-Fi Protocol, ESP8266-01 Wi-Fi Modem and Arduino UNO

  • What is Wi-Fi?
  • How the Wi-Fi Works?
  • ESP8266 Wi-Fi Modem
  • Different Types of ESP8266 Wi-Fi Modems
  • Pin outs of ESP8266-01 Wi-Fi Modems
  • AT Commands of ESP8266-01
  • Configuring ESP8266-01
  • ESP8266-01 Wi-Fi Modem Interfacing with Arduino UNO
  • ESP8266-01 Wi-Fi Modem as Client with Arduino UNO over Internet
  • ESP8266-01 Wi-Fi Modem based LED Control with Arduino UNO over Internet
  • Application of Wi-Fi

Practicals and Projects

  • LED Interfacing with Arduino UNO
  • LED Blinking with Arduino UNO
  • 16X2 Alphanumeric LCD Interfacing with Arduino UNO
  • Horizontal Scrolling in 16X2 Alphanumeric LCD with Arduino UNO
  • Arduino UNO to PC Communication with LCD Display
  • PC to Arduino UNO Communication with LCD Display
  • Full Duplex Communication between PC and Arduino UNO with LCD Display
  • Microcontroller to Microcontroller Communication with Arduino UNO and LCD Display using Software Serial
  • Microcontroller to Microcontroller Full Duplex Communication with Arduino UNO and LCD Display using Software Serial
  • Microcontroller to Microcontroller Communication with Arduino UNO and Serial Monitor using Software Serial
  • Microcontroller to Microcontroller Full Duplex Communication with Arduino UNO and Serial Monitor using Software Serial
  • Analog to Digital Converter of Arduino UNO and Serial Monitor
  • Analog to Digital Converter of Arduino UNO and LCD Display
  • MQ-5 LPG Gas Sensor Interfacing with Arduino UNO and Serial Monitor
  • MQ-5 LPG Gas Sensor Interfacing with Arduino UNO and LCD Display
  • LM35 Temperature Sensor Interfacing with Arduino UNO and Serial Monitor
  • LM35 Temperature Sensor Interfacing with Arduino UNO and LCD Display
  • L293D based DC Motor Driver Interfacing with Arduino UNO in 5V Mode
  • Relay Interfacing with Arduino UNO
  • ESP8266-01 Wi-Fi Modem Interfacing with Arduino UNO
  • ESP8266-01 Wi-Fi Modem as Client with Arduino UNO over Internet
  • ESP8266-01 Wi-Fi Modem based LED Control with Arduino UNO over Internet
  • ESP8266-01 Wi-Fi Modem and MQ-5 Sensor based LPG Gas Monitoring with Arduino UNO over Internet
  • ESP8266-01 Wi-Fi Modem and LM35 Sensor based Temperature Monitoring with Arduino UNO over Internet
  • LM35 Temperature and MQ-5 LPG Gas Sensor based Data Acquisition System using ESP8266-01 Wi-Fi Modem over Internet
  • ESP8266-01 Wi-Fi Modem based DC Motor Control with Arduino UNO over Internet
  • ESP8266-01 Wi-Fi Modem based Home Appliances Control with Arduino UNO over Internet

Kits Detail

  • Arduino UNO Board-1pc
  • USB AM-BM Cable-1pc
  • 16X2 Alphanumeric LCD-1pc
  • DC Motor Driver-1pc
  • DC Motor-1pc
  • LM35 Temperature Sensor Board-1pc
  • MQ-5 Gas Sensor Board-1pc
  • Quad Relay Driver Board-1pc
  • ESP8266-01 Wi-Fi Module-1pc
  • ESP8266-01 and LCD Interfacing Board-1pc
  • 12V, 1A Adaptor-1pc
  • 1 to 1 M-F Connector -10pcs
  • 1 to 1 F-F Connector -10pcs

Study Materials

  • Sample Codes
  • Circuit Diagrams
  • Softwares and their Installation and User Guides
  • Header Files
  • Datasheets
  • User Manuals

Materials

  • Sample Codes
  • Circuit Diagrams
  • Softwares and their Installation and User Guides
  • Datasheets
  • User Manuals

Course Detail

  • Course Duration:- 50 Hours(17 Days)
  • Course Fee:- Rs.9,999.00/-(Inclusive of All Taxes)
  • Certificate to each participant at the end of the Training Program. 

Who Can Apply?

All B.E/ B-Tech, M.E/ M-Tech & Hobbyists with knowledge of Electronics, Digital Electronics and C Programming can attend.

What If i am having any Query?

For any query, Please contact:-8984089851 or mail us at info@ablab.in.